In her videos, Alison outlines three fundamental rules for anyone starting their savings journey. Her approach aims to help individuals grasp their finances better and establish a clear roadmap for saving.
1. Track Your Spending
“You need to understand your money before you can grow it,” Alison advises. She highlights the importance of meticulously tracking every expense, no matter how small. This process may seem tedious initially, but Alison assures that it only takes a few minutes each day and will pay off in the long run.
2. Identify Spending Leaks
After a few weeks of tracking expenses, individuals can pinpoint areas where their spending might be excessive or unnecessary. For example, impulsive purchases during grocery shopping or opting for takeout instead of preparing a meal at home can lead to significant leaks in one’s budget.
3. Implement Changes with a Spending Tracker
Once you identify your spending leaks, it’s time to strategize on how to minimize those expenses. Alison encourages setting up a structured budget that includes all essential categories, such as rent, bills, and groceries, alongside a personal allowance for discretionary spending. This balanced approach can enhance your savings while ensuring you still enjoy some flexibility in your financial life.
